Struct PeerCapabilityRegistry 

Source
pub struct PeerCapabilityRegistry { /* private fields */ }
Expand description

Tick-based registry tracking which protocol-level Capability set each peer advertises.

This is the primary data structure for capability-based peer selection. Advertisements carry a TTL expressed in ticks; callers must supply the current tick to all query operations so that expired entries are correctly filtered out without requiring a background eviction task.

§Example

use ipfrs_network::capability_registry::{
    Capability, PeerCapabilityRegistry,
};

let mut registry = PeerCapabilityRegistry::new();
registry.advertise(
    "peer-a".to_string(),
    vec![Capability::Kademlia, Capability::Bitswap { version: 1 }],
    /*current_tick=*/ 0,
    /*ttl_ticks=*/ 100,
);

let peers = registry.peers_with_capability(&Capability::Kademlia, 0);
assert_eq!(peers, vec!["peer-a"]);

Implementations§

Source§

impl PeerCapabilityRegistry

Source

pub fn new() -> Self

Create an empty registry.

Source

pub fn advertise( &mut self, peer_id: String, capabilities: Vec<Capability>, current_tick: u64, ttl_ticks: u64, )

Insert or replace the advertisement for peer_id.

The advertisement expires at tick current_tick + ttl_ticks.

Source

pub fn peers_with_capability( &self, cap: &Capability, current_tick: u64, ) -> Vec<&str>

Return a sorted list of peer IDs whose valid advertisements include cap.

Only advertisements that pass CapabilityAdvertisement::is_valid at current_tick are considered. The result is sorted alphabetically.

Source

pub fn peer_capabilities( &self, peer_id: &str, current_tick: u64, ) -> Option<&[Capability]>

Return the capability slice for peer_id if its advertisement is valid at current_tick, or None otherwise.

Returns None when:

  • the peer is not in the registry, or
  • the peer’s advertisement has expired.
Source

pub fn remove_peer(&mut self, peer_id: &str) -> bool

Remove the advertisement for peer_id.

Returns true if the peer was found and removed, false if the peer was not registered.

Source

pub fn evict_expired(&mut self, current_tick: u64) -> usize

Remove all expired advertisements from the registry.

Returns the number of advertisements that were removed.

Source

pub fn stats(&self, current_tick: u64) -> CapabilityRegistryStats

Return a CapabilityRegistryStats snapshot evaluated at current_tick.
